Get This Out My Face! Canadian Women’s Hockey Player Immediately Removes Silver Medal After Losing

We all can get competitive when we’re playing sports but some things you just don’t do, especially on television! A Canadian women’s hockey player, Jocelyne Larocque, was salty about winning a silver medal after being being defeated by the U.S. team because sis took the medal off as soon as it was placed around her neck!

“It’s just hard,” Larocque said. “You work so hard. We wanted gold but didn’t get it.”

Jocelyne got a little heat on social media from
people who just weren’t feelin’ her attitude.

“Poor sportsmanship,” one woman posted on Twitter. “You can’t win every time. Wait until you’re off the ice to be bitter and salty.”

The way she ripped that medal off one would think she never even had a gold one! Turns out Jocelyne was apart of Canada’s winning team back in 2014.

She was told that she can’t legally refuse to wear the medal and put it back on later on!
